The Secret to Big Style in Small Spaces

When people imagine a Walk In Closet NYC style, they often picture expansive dressing rooms filled with custom cabinetry, glass doors, and lavish lighting. But the essence of a high-end look isn’t about size — it’s about how the space is designed and organized. Even a compact walk-in or reach-in closet can exude luxury when you focus on layout, materials, and lighting.

Start by maximizing vertical space. Many small walk-ins waste valuable room above and below hanging rods. Use the full height of your walls — install double rods for short garments, add shelving near the ceiling for off-season items, and include drawers or cabinets below for folded clothing. By thinking vertically, you not only increase storage but also create a more polished, built-in appearance.

Lighting is another game-changer. A single overhead bulb won’t do your closet justice. Instead, layer lighting to highlight key areas — recessed ceiling lights for overall brightness, LED strips under shelves for accent lighting, and perhaps a statement chandelier for elegance. The right lighting brings depth, warmth, and a boutique-like ambiance to even the smallest spaces.

Choose Finishes That Elevate the Look

Materials and finishes can instantly determine whether your closet feels high-end or standard. In small spaces, opt for light, reflective finishes like glossy white, soft beige, or pale wood tones to make the room feel open and airy. You can also mix textures — for instance, pairing matte cabinetry with glass doors or adding brushed metal handles for a sophisticated touch.

Don’t underestimate the power of uniformity. Matching hangers, coordinated bins, and neatly labeled drawers make your closet appear curated and cohesive. Clear or frosted drawers can display your accessories beautifully, while mirrored doors visually expand the space. Small design touches — like velvet-lined jewelry drawers or leather-trimmed storage boxes — add that quiet sense of luxury.

If your goal is a high-end aesthetic, avoid clutter at all costs. Luxury design thrives on simplicity. Keep only what you love and use, then give each item a designated spot. The result isn’t just a functional closet — it’s a space that feels intentional and serene.

Optimize Every Inch with Smart Storage Solutions

In a small walk-in closet, every square inch counts. Customization is key to achieving a high-end look without sacrificing functionality. Built-in drawers, pull-out racks, and adjustable shelves create a streamlined, professional layout.

One trick designers use is creating zones. Dedicate different sections for clothes, shoes, and accessories, even in limited space. This makes it easier to find what you need and gives your closet a balanced, organized appearance.

Consider adding:

  • Pull-out shelves for shoes or handbags

  • Hidden compartments for jewelry and valuables

  • Slide-out mirrors to save space while keeping convenience

  • Hooks and racks inside doors for belts, scarves, or ties

Adding doors or panels to conceal clutter also makes a huge difference. Even frosted glass doors can give your closet a sleek, built-in furniture feel rather than a storage area.

The Role of Lighting and Mirrors

Good lighting and mirrors don’t just enhance functionality — they transform the entire mood of your closet. A combination of soft, warm lighting and reflective surfaces creates the illusion of space and luxury.

Install mirrors strategically — either as full-length panels or as part of your closet doors. Mirrors reflect light, making the area appear twice as large. Pair them with adjustable LED lights that mimic natural daylight, so your colors and fabrics look true when getting dressed.

For a boutique-inspired effect, try backlighting your shelving or adding small LED spotlights above display areas. It not only highlights your favorite pieces but also creates that “wow” factor every time you step in.

Personalization Makes It Truly Luxurious

What separates a high-end closet from an ordinary one is how it reflects your personality. Custom touches make even small spaces feel exclusive. Display your most-used accessories — watches, handbags, or perfumes — in glass-front drawers or open shelves. Add a small plush rug, a velvet stool, or framed artwork to bring warmth and elegance.

If space allows, include a narrow bench or ottoman in the center — not just for seating, but as a visual focal point. If not, a soft area rug can add texture and coziness. The goal is to make your closet feel like your own mini dressing room, not just a storage zone.

Organization also plays a huge role in luxury. Keep everything categorized and color-coordinated. Hanging similar items together — like grouping shirts, jackets, and dresses — gives a boutique-like look. Small organizational details, like drawer dividers or coordinated baskets, elevate the overall appearance.
